Чтение из App.config в проекте библиотеки классов

Я разрабатываю простой проект библиотеки классов , который даст мне dll.

Я хотел, чтобы из конфигурационного файла читалось конкретное значение. Поэтому я добавил в свой проект файл App.config.

 <?xml version="1.0" encoding="utf-8" ?>
 <configuration>

  <appSettings>
  <add key="serviceUrl" value="test value" />
  </appSettings>

  </configuration>

Выше приведен мой файл App.config, и теперь я пытаюсь прочитать его следующим образом.

  string strVal = System.Configuration.ConfigurationManager.AppSettings["serviceUrl"];

Но я не получаю никакого значения в своей строковой переменной.

enter image description here

Я сделал это для веб-приложения аналогичным образом, и это сработало. Но почему-то я не могу заставить это работать.

Верна ли вообще идея наличия App.config в проекте библиотеки классов?

16
задан Darren 29 May 2012 в 11:30
поделиться